The U.S. Department of Energy (DOE) is proposing to provide federal funding to the University of California San Diego (UCSD) for the design, optimization, fabrication and testing of the metasurface solar concentrators. Proposed activities are generally laboratory-scale investigations; materials fabrication; data analysis; and in-lab testing to increase its lifetime using humidity and temperature testing. This NEPA review applies to all Budget Periods (BP) and activities proposed under this award.

Design and characterization of small-scale samples would be completed by UCSD at their lab and clean room facilities on campus in La Jolla, CA. Fabrication would be completed at both UCSD and Sandia National Labs (SNL) in Albuquerque, NM. SNL would complete in-lab testing of large-scale samples. The facilities in which lab work would occur are purpose-built for the type of activities being proposed. No change in the use, mission or operation of existing facilities would arise out of this effort. The facilities have all applicable permits in place, and would not need additional permits for the proposed activities.
